Drake Maye, the highly coveted quarterback, found his new home with the New England Patriots, who drafted him at No. 3. The first round of the draft even made history with 23 offensive players selected, including Maye, a new record-breaking feat. Among the lot, Maye was the best quarterback on the board when the Patriots drafted him. His outstanding 63.3% pass completion rate at North Carolina made him the obvious choice for the team.

However, the Patriots’ offensive upgrades didn’t stop there. After making some smart trades, they’ve drafted former Washington wide receiver Ja’Lynn Polk to join their new quarterback. Drake Maye seems thrilled about the pick and has already supported his new teammate.

Drake Maye approves the selection of his new teammate

The New England Patriots strategically traded down three spots from their initial No. 34 pick in the 2024 NFL Draft. And they used their new selection (pick No. 37) to bolster their offense. To everyone’s surprise, they went ahead with former Washington wide receiver Ja’Lynn Polk. In the coming season, he will team up with their highly touted new quarterback, Drake Maye. Right after the announcement, Maye showed his excitement on social media, posting, “Stud!! Let’s work.” This simple three-word message now hints at an exciting partnership on the horizon.

Ja’Lynn Polk — the wide receiver who starred at Washington — now can thrive alongside Maye. The two new Patriots stars might become a powerful pair in the coming years, making games at Gillette Stadium exciting.

Maye and Ja’Lynn Polk: A partnership to keep eyes on

Instead of trying to refill the Tom Brady void, the Patriots are now making big changes to their entire offensive strategy. The team desperately needed a better quarterback and wide receiver, and that’s exactly who they picked. Their first move was drafting Drake Maye, a quarterback with the much-needed star potential. But they didn’t stop there. In the second round, they snagged a talented wide receiver with a stellar final season at Washington.

Polk caught passes for 1,159 yards and has nine touchdowns. He’s also got the size and skills to immediately impact the field, especially since the Patriots lack other strong receivers. The Patriots, who have struggled the last few seasons, needed to add some serious talents that could make an immediate impact. Now, they have both Maye and Ja’Lynn Polk to rely on. These two new players should make their offense much stronger, and if they live up to expectations, the Patriots could be a force to be reckoned with every year.
